1.5KE12C - TVS Diode

Product Overview

Category:

1.5KE12C belongs to the category of Transient Voltage Suppressor (TVS) diodes.

Use:

It is used to protect sensitive electronic components from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.

Characteristics:

  • Fast response time
  • Low clamping voltage
  • High surge current capability

Package:

The 1.5KE12C TVS diode is typically available in a DO-201 package.

Essence:

The essence of the 1.5KE12C TVS diode lies in its ability to divert excessive current away from sensitive components, thereby safeguarding them from damage due to voltage spikes.

Working Principles

When a transient voltage event occurs, the 1.5KE12C TVS diode conducts current to divert the excess energy away from the protected circuit, thus limiting the voltage across it.
